I have a 3.5 year old male cat. I thought that he might be some sort of hybrid wild cat. He has some of the most interesting characteristics. For one, he has a 6th toe on one of his back feet. He has a lot of odd markings also. but also he turns very ferrell at times. He attacks me . He lets out a very odd scream and just goes. He just goes crazy. Hes very large. And his try are way bigger than the female cat that I have. I've had cats my whole life. And I have never had a cat like him. He is very interesting. His paws are larger than most cats, he makes odd barks and noises all the time. Hes very territorial also. I'm just not sure what to make of his behavior sometimes. He is I'm a very good cat dont get me wrong. Any thoughts?

Do you have pictures? It's hard to tell anything without them. But polydactyly (extra toes) isn't generally seen in wildcats.

As for his behavior, is he neutered? Intact male cats can be somewhat aggressive sometimes.
